Subsidence on front porch extension?

SAFCDan
SAFCDan Posts: 1 Newbie
I've recently bought and moved into my first house (start of June), and there appears to be some subsidence at the front of the porch extension, which was built roughly 20 years ago (The house itself is 30 years old). I can't say for certain that it happened recently, but can't say that we've really noticed it until now!

For what it's worth it wasn't picked up in the Home Buyers Report so it's possible the recent hot and dry spell hasn't helped :(
